Yalile Suriel Zoom Event: Thursday, Nov 12, 2020 at 4:00 pm - Registration Deadline Wednesday, Nov  11.
A lecture by Yalile Suriel, PhD candidate in History, "Policing University Space: How Law and Order Infiltrated the Campus". Robert Chase/History, respondent. Part of the “Abolitionists Futures” Series. This talk examines how diversity narratives collided with punitive discourses at public universities.
